三種方法讀取鍵值 使用者設(shè)計(jì)行列鍵盤介面,一般常採用三種方法讀取鍵值。 中斷式 在鍵盤按下時產(chǎn)生一個外部中斷通知CPU,並由中斷處理程式通過不同位址讀資料線上的狀態(tài)判斷哪個按鍵被按下。 本實(shí)驗(yàn)採用中斷式實(shí)現(xiàn)使用者鍵盤介面。 掃描法 對鍵盤上的某一行送低電位,其他為高電位,然後讀取列值,若列值中有一位是低,表明該行與低電位對應(yīng)列的鍵被按下。否則掃描下一行。 反轉(zhuǎn)法 先將所有行掃描線輸出低電位,讀列值,若列值有一位是低表明有鍵按下;接著所有列掃描線輸出低電位,再讀行值。 根據(jù)讀到的值組合就可以查表得到鍵碼。4x4鍵盤按4行4列組成如圖電路結(jié)構(gòu)。按鍵按下將會使行列連成通路,這也是見的使用者鍵盤設(shè)計(jì)電路。 //-----------4X4鍵盤程序--------------// uchar keboard(void) { uchar xxa,yyb,i,key; if((PINC&0x0f)!=0x0f) //是否有按鍵按下 {delayms(1); //延時去抖動 if((PINC&0x0f)!=0x0f) //有按下則判斷 { xxa=~(PINC|0xf0); //0000xxxx DDRC=0x0f; PORTC=0xf0; delay_1ms(); yyb=~(PINC|0x0f); //xxxx0000 DDRC=0xf0; //復(fù)位 PORTC=0x0f; while((PINC&0x0f)!=0x0f) //按鍵是否放開 { display(data); } i=4; //計(jì)算返回碼 while(xxa!=0) { xxa=xxa>>1; i--; } if(yyb==0x80) key=i; else if(yyb==0x40) key=4+i; else if(yyb==0x20) key=8+i; else if(yyb==0x10) key=12+i; return key; //返回按下的鍵盤碼 } } else return 17; //沒有按鍵按下 }
上傳時間: 2013-11-12
上傳用戶:a673761058
Altera公司SoC FPGA產(chǎn)品簡介高級信息摘要(英文資料) 圖 硬件處理系統(tǒng)
標(biāo)簽: Altera FPGA SoC 產(chǎn)品簡介
上傳時間: 2014-12-28
上傳用戶:TRIFCT
信息處理機(jī)(圖1)用于完成導(dǎo)彈上多路遙測信息的采集、處理、組包發(fā)送。主要功能包括高速1553B總線的數(shù)據(jù)收發(fā)、422接口設(shè)備的數(shù)據(jù)加載與檢測、多路數(shù)據(jù)融合和數(shù)據(jù)接收、處理、組包發(fā)送的功能。其中,總線數(shù)據(jù)和其他422接口送來的數(shù)據(jù)同時進(jìn)行并行處理;各路輸入信息按預(yù)定格式進(jìn)行融合與輸出;數(shù)據(jù)輸出速率以高速同步422口的幀同步脈沖為源,如果高速同步422口異常不影響總線數(shù)據(jù)和其它422口的數(shù)據(jù)融合與輸出功能。在CPU發(fā)生異常或總線數(shù)據(jù)異常時不影響其它422口數(shù)據(jù)的融合與輸出功能;能夠?qū)目偩€上接收的數(shù)據(jù)進(jìn)行二次篩選、組包,并發(fā)送往總線,供其它設(shè)備接收。
標(biāo)簽: FPGA 信息處理 中的應(yīng)用
上傳時間: 2013-11-22
上傳用戶:suicone
針對國家突發(fā)公共事件應(yīng)急體系建設(shè)規(guī)劃的要求,設(shè)計(jì)了一種基于Web和GIS的災(zāi)害預(yù)警信息管理系統(tǒng),建立了同一地理空間下的省、地市、縣三級災(zāi)害信息管理與發(fā)布的預(yù)警機(jī)制。研制了基于GSM/GPRS通信的預(yù)警信息語音發(fā)布一體機(jī)和圖文LED電子屏,通過短信和語音的將預(yù)警信息大范圍發(fā)布。本系統(tǒng)已在多省市不同領(lǐng)域廣泛應(yīng)用,尤其是在氣象信息管理與發(fā)布領(lǐng)域發(fā)揮了重要作用。
標(biāo)簽: Web GIS 預(yù)警 信息管理系統(tǒng)
上傳時間: 2013-10-20
上傳用戶:ardager
針對果園環(huán)境遠(yuǎn)程實(shí)時監(jiān)測的需求,設(shè)計(jì)了MCU芯片MSP430F149、射頻芯片nRF2401及各種傳感器接入電路構(gòu)成的具有多種果園環(huán)境信息監(jiān)測的無線傳感網(wǎng)絡(luò)節(jié)點(diǎn)。該節(jié)點(diǎn)系統(tǒng)采集果園微氣象信息(包括溫度、濕度、光照強(qiáng)度等),通過節(jié)點(diǎn)之間的無線通信,以多跳的方式傳給上位監(jiān)控機(jī),可實(shí)現(xiàn)果園環(huán)境信息的遠(yuǎn)距離實(shí)時監(jiān)測。
標(biāo)簽: 環(huán)境 無線傳感器網(wǎng)絡(luò) 監(jiān)測 節(jié)點(diǎn)設(shè)計(jì)
上傳時間: 2014-11-12
上傳用戶:金宜
我國自主研制的北斗二代衛(wèi)星導(dǎo)航定位系統(tǒng)已具備區(qū)域?qū)Ш蕉ㄎ坏哪芰Γ闹幸訠D2/GPS雙系統(tǒng)導(dǎo)航接收機(jī)為研究對象,研究BD2/GPS雙系統(tǒng)接收機(jī)的通信協(xié)議,給出BD2/GPS雙系統(tǒng)接收機(jī)的數(shù)據(jù)采集方法,詳細(xì)設(shè)計(jì)了基于VC++的BD2/GPS接收機(jī)信息處理與分析軟件,并給出其軟件流程,研究了接收機(jī)定位性能的評價指標(biāo),并提取BD2/GPS聯(lián)合定位時的狀態(tài)參數(shù)以及精度因子。同時,實(shí)現(xiàn)了計(jì)算機(jī)對BD2/GPS雙系統(tǒng)接收機(jī)的設(shè)置與控制。通過實(shí)際測試和調(diào)試表明:設(shè)計(jì)的BD2/GPS接收機(jī)信息采集與處理系統(tǒng)工作穩(wěn)定,界面友好,擴(kuò)展性強(qiáng),可用于對BD2/GPS雙系統(tǒng)接收機(jī)定位性能進(jìn)行分析。
標(biāo)簽: GPS BD 信息采集 與處理系統(tǒng)
上傳時間: 2013-11-17
上傳用戶:baitouyu
隨著科技的迅速發(fā)展,網(wǎng)絡(luò)覆蓋面快速擴(kuò)大,網(wǎng)絡(luò)信息技術(shù)正逐漸改變著人類生活的方方面面。基于深入了解網(wǎng)絡(luò)信息技術(shù)在社會生活中的應(yīng)用情況的目的,本文從企業(yè)發(fā)展、國民教育、政府管理和農(nóng)業(yè)產(chǎn)業(yè)化發(fā)展四個方面闡述分析了網(wǎng)絡(luò)信息技術(shù)的應(yīng)用情況。通過應(yīng)用前后的對比,發(fā)現(xiàn)了網(wǎng)絡(luò)信息技術(shù)給社會帶來了巨大變革,很大程度上改變了人們的工作、學(xué)習(xí)、生活和生產(chǎn)方式。最后本文探討了今后網(wǎng)絡(luò)信息技術(shù)在社會生活中的發(fā)展方向。
標(biāo)簽: 網(wǎng)絡(luò) 信息技術(shù)
上傳時間: 2013-12-11
上傳用戶:sunshine1402
隨著計(jì)算機(jī)以及現(xiàn)代化技術(shù)的發(fā)展,現(xiàn)代高等學(xué)校對開發(fā)科研信息管理系統(tǒng)對加強(qiáng)科研管理有著非常迫切的需要。論文在高校科研管理系統(tǒng)需求分析的基礎(chǔ)上,對系統(tǒng)主要模塊以及數(shù)據(jù)庫進(jìn)行了分析和設(shè)計(jì),實(shí)現(xiàn)了該系統(tǒng)。論文最后對高校科研管理系統(tǒng)做出總結(jié)和展望。
標(biāo)簽: 科研 信息管理系統(tǒng)
上傳時間: 2013-11-13
上傳用戶:思琦琦
在車載自組網(wǎng)中,路由協(xié)議很大程度上決定了整個網(wǎng)絡(luò)的性能。如何有效的利用車流信息提高傳輸質(zhì)量是改善路由性能的一個關(guān)鍵問題。本文基于速度-密度線性模型,提出了一種實(shí)時車流密度的路由協(xié)議RVDR(Real-time Vehicle Density Routing)。該協(xié)議通過與鄰居節(jié)點(diǎn)交換的速度信息,對相關(guān)道路車流密度進(jìn)行預(yù)測,并給出基于車流密度信息的路徑選擇方法。仿真結(jié)果表明,與現(xiàn)有協(xié)議相比,RVDR協(xié)議在實(shí)時性和高效性等性能方面得到改進(jìn)。
上傳時間: 2014-07-10
上傳用戶:ZJX5201314
電話信令收發(fā)器CMX860在信息終端中的應(yīng)用
標(biāo)簽: CMX 860 電話信令 收發(fā)器
上傳時間: 2013-10-19
上傳用戶:sy_jiadeyi
蟲蟲下載站版權(quán)所有 京ICP備2021023401號-1